be2net: refactor be_set_rx_mode() and be_vid_config() for readability



This patch re-factors the filter setting (uc-list, mc-list, promisc, vlan)
code in be_set_rx_mode() and be_vid_config() to make it more readable
and reduce code duplication.
This patch adds a separate field to track the state/mode of filtering,
along with moving all the filtering related fields to one place in be
be_adapter structure.
